Getting Around the Roosevelt Neighborhood in Seattle, WA

Walk Score®

92 / 100

Walker’s Paradise

Daily errands do not require a car

Bike Score®

93 / 100

Biker's Paradise

Daily errands can be accomplished on a bike

Transit Score®

66 / 100

Good Transit

Many nearby public transportation options

Frequently Asked Questions about Roosevelt

How much are Studio apartments in Roosevelt?

There are currently 68 Studio Apartments in Roosevelt with rent ranges from $975 to $2,775 with an average price of $1,489.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Roosevelt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Roosevelt ranges from $1,484 to $3,536 with an average monthly rent of $2,297.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Roosevelt c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Roosevelt range from $1,969 to $4,175.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,033.
